Output 839188feba37693ee5b274f5392056d613d918b7232c7fc242b8db175389684f:1

value
2376500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 448e5345022ee1764cb6ca06a4181f983923acd8 OP_EQUALVERIFY OP_CHECKSIG
address
17FVSyi2dCqfkaKPH7etRC9sE13xLLWh8T
transaction
839188feba37693ee5b274f5392056d613d918b7232c7fc242b8db175389684f
spent
true